Lafayette Square across from the White House has been closed since January for a restoration project that was expected to end in May. Now federal officials are advancing a permanent fencing plan that could reshape public access to one of Washington’s most visible civic spaces.
Treasury Secretary Scott Bessent said this summer that U.S. drivers could see gas prices with a $3 handle by Labor Day. By the holiday weekend, national pump prices were above $4, and Vice President JD Vance said conflict tied to Iranian attacks on commercial shipping was a key reason.
The Trump administration has proposed new tax rules that would let the IRS strip private schools and colleges of tax-exempt status for race-based student programs. Officials are grounding the move in a 1983 Supreme Court ruling once used to deny a tax break to Bob Jones University.
National Weather Service offices are warning of dangerous beach conditions along parts of the California coast this Labor Day weekend. Officials said long-period swell could raise the risk of sneaker waves, strong rip currents and rough surf from Friday into Monday.
The Justice Department asked the Supreme Court on September 3 to let the Postal Service enforce new mail ballot rules ahead of the November midterms. The emergency appeal comes as states say the requirements could disrupt ballots already being prepared or mailed.
